St. Anthony's Church and School
-
Image nop
- Date Created: 1944
- Description: Graduating Class of 1944 at St. Anthony School, with Rev. Edmund Marion, pastor. Attendees can be seen in the background. The school was opened on Oct. 1, 1931 and had as many as 400 students. Fr. Marion became pastor in 1940 after having served in many parishes, and began renovations at the school as well as a hot lunch program.

Vergennes High School - Students & Faculty
-
Image nop
- Date Created: 1944
- Description: 1944 photo of faculty and students in front of Vergennes High School. The school was built in 1871, replaced by the union high school in 1959, and demolished in 1964.
